Output e39f57234eccdfcfbe1e91f54b9bbf109ff53920f7e54092e93751f266837461:0

value
989254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ec09c27f7e90ae22e36e52d6cbcc5f849fbe6012 OP_EQUAL
address
3PD55wDcaQ6j8tvW3TFyHJ8ciF1gnVUifU
transaction
e39f57234eccdfcfbe1e91f54b9bbf109ff53920f7e54092e93751f266837461
spent
true